5.4 Guidelines for Capacity and Resolution

Crane scales are subject to forces that regular floor scales do not see. Many bridge cranes, hoist cranes and mobile cranes lack 

rigidity and tend to bounce or swing when loads are lifted. For this reason, Rice Lake Weighing Systems recommends that the 

resolution is kept in the 1:2000 to 1:3000 range. Some improvement in stability can be achieved by increasing the filtering. 

Never program the resolution higher than needed. If the

 

MSI-4260 IS

 

display is never stable, it is recommended that the 

resolution is reduced and/or filtering increased. 

Due to Legal for Trade requirements and general scale design criteria, the weight must be stable for certain features to work:

• ZERO – the weight must be stable to be zeroed

• TARE – the weight must be stable to be tared

• TOTAL – the weight must be stable to be added to the total registers

One way to improve the stability is to increase the filtering, at the risk of increasing settling time. The other is to increase the ‘d’ 

(reduce resolution). The third way is to increase the Motion Window. The MSI-4260 IS defaults to ±1d as a motion window. It 

can be changed at Rice Lake to a higher value if desired. Often ±3d is chosen for bridge cranes as these tend to have a lot of 

bounce to them. This of course carries an accuracy penalty adding ±3 d to the total accuracy of the scale if the zero or tare 

operation happens to capture the weight in a valley or peak.

Setting capacity is dictated primarily by the capability of the load cell. Rice Lake supplies the MSI-4260 IS in many capacities.

  Never set the capacity of the scale higher than the rating of the load cell.

Due to excellent linearity of the MSI S-Beam load cell, it is acceptable to set lower capacities to better match the crane that the 

MSI-4260 IS is used on. For example, if the hoist is rated for 9000 lb, then use a 10000 lb. weight and reset the capacity to 9000 

lb. Use the Initial Calibration procedure for this calibration. De-rating as much as 50% of the capacity is usually acceptable, but 

the scale may be less stable if the d is decreased.

Due to kg to lb conversions, the capacity of all

 

MSI-4260 IS systems is rated approximately 20% higher than the rated capacity 

in pounds. This is to allow the kg capacity to be exactly 1/2 the number of the pound capacity.
